1 # SPDX-License-Identifier: GPL-2.0-only 1 # SPDX-License-Identifier: GPL-2.0-only 2 # Qualcomm IPC Router configuration 2 # Qualcomm IPC Router configuration 3 # 3 # 4 4 5 config QRTR 5 config QRTR 6 tristate "Qualcomm IPC Router support" 6 tristate "Qualcomm IPC Router support" 7 help 7 help 8 Say Y if you intend to use Qualcomm 8 Say Y if you intend to use Qualcomm IPC router protocol. The 9 protocol is used to communicate with 9 protocol is used to communicate with services provided by other 10 hardware blocks in the system. 10 hardware blocks in the system. 11 11 12 In order to do service lookups, a us 12 In order to do service lookups, a userspace daemon is required to 13 maintain a service listing. 13 maintain a service listing. 14 14 15 if QRTR 15 if QRTR 16 16 17 config QRTR_SMD 17 config QRTR_SMD 18 tristate "SMD IPC Router channels" 18 tristate "SMD IPC Router channels" 19 depends on RPMSG || (COMPILE_TEST && R 19 depends on RPMSG || (COMPILE_TEST && RPMSG=n) 20 help 20 help 21 Say Y here to support SMD based ipcr 21 Say Y here to support SMD based ipcrouter channels. SMD is the 22 most common transport for IPC Router 22 most common transport for IPC Router. 23 23 24 config QRTR_TUN 24 config QRTR_TUN 25 tristate "TUN device for Qualcomm IPC 25 tristate "TUN device for Qualcomm IPC Router" 26 help 26 help 27 Say Y here to expose a character dev 27 Say Y here to expose a character device that allows user space to 28 implement endpoints of QRTR, for pur 28 implement endpoints of QRTR, for purpose of tunneling data to other 29 hosts or testing purposes. 29 hosts or testing purposes. 30 30 31 config QRTR_MHI 31 config QRTR_MHI 32 tristate "MHI IPC Router channels" 32 tristate "MHI IPC Router channels" 33 depends on MHI_BUS 33 depends on MHI_BUS 34 help 34 help 35 Say Y here to support MHI based ipcr 35 Say Y here to support MHI based ipcrouter channels. MHI is the 36 transport used for communicating to 36 transport used for communicating to external modems. 37 37 38 endif # QRTR 38 endif # QRTR
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.